Форум АНТИЧАТ

Форум АНТИЧАТ (https://forum.antichat.xyz/index.php)
-   С/С++, C#, Delphi, .NET, Asm (https://forum.antichat.xyz/forumdisplay.php?f=24)
-   -   Winrar (https://forum.antichat.xyz/showthread.php?t=131408)

Sin3v 26.07.2009 08:49

Winrar
 
Как зацепиться к винрару через делфи чтобы пароль подбирать?
а то сцука пасс забыл на рар

slesh 26.07.2009 09:36

а смысл? Самый быстрый способ подбирать пас - это юзая спец проги, которые для этого предназначены, а если юзать DLL винрара то это намного медленне пашет чем через проги.
Но если архив был сделать винраром версии > 2,7 то смысла брутить нету, разве что по словарю. Потому как ты получишь скорость неболее 200 пасов в секунду.
А это значит что только твои правнуки в лучшем случае смогут дождаться пароль.

SmanxX1 26.07.2009 10:58

Цитата:

Сообщение от slesh
Потому как ты получишь скорость неболее 200 пасов в секунду.

Неправда! С парочкой топовых видюшек скорость ~6к в секунду.

slesh 26.07.2009 12:33

А где ты видел реализацию брута rar архивов на CUDA?

Если учесть что 66 русских букв + 10 цифр + 48 англ букв, то выходит 124 символа + 6 знаков препинания, то 130 вариантов. Если пароль 8 символов. то выходи 81573072100000000 вариантов.
При скорости 6k в секунду будеш брутить:
13595512016666 секунду.
3776531115 - часов
157355463 - суток
431110 - годов
431 - тысячелетие (так что не факт что вообще доживем)

А если предположить что пароль только англ символы 24 варианта и длинна 8 символов
то это займет 212 суток.

Так что дохлый номер. Ну если конечно пароль чисто цифровой, тогда можно за 5 часов подобрать при 10x8 и скорости 6k

SmanxX1 26.07.2009 13:09

Цитата:

А где ты видел реализацию брута rar архивов на CUDA?
Например, вот: http://www.golubev.com/rargpu.htm

Цитата:

Если учесть что 66 русских букв + 10 цифр + 48 англ букв, то выходит 124 символа + 6 знаков препинания, то 130 вариантов. Если пароль 8 символов. то выходи 81573072100000000 вариантов.
При скорости 6k в секунду будеш брутить:
13595512016666 секунду.
3776531115 - часов
157355463 - суток
431110 - годов
431 - тысячелетие (так что не факт что вообще доживем)

А если предположить что пароль только англ символы 24 варианта и длинна 8 символов
то это займет 212 суток.

Так что дохлый номер. Ну если конечно пароль чисто цифровой, тогда можно за 5 часов подобрать при 10x8 и скорости 6k
Все твои предположения и расчеты ничего не стоят, парой хватает пары минут рассуждений и немножко удачи. =) А если серьезно, то для таких целей делаются "вычислительные сети" по типу Folding@Home (немного неудачный пример но все же), или же банальные ботнеты специально для этих целей.

Kaimi 26.07.2009 13:51

Цитата:

Все твои предположения и расчеты ничего не стоят, парой хватает пары минут рассуждений и немножко удачи. =) А если серьезно, то для таких целей делаются "вычислительные сети" по типу Folding@Home (немного неудачный пример но все же), или же банальные ботнеты специально для этих целей.
Так может тебе скинуть архивчик с паролем на 14 символов, а ты подберешь пароль с помощью рассуждений и удачи, попутно создав "вычислительную сеть" или банальный ботнет?

SmanxX1 26.07.2009 14:05

Kaimi
Это типа ты так сумничал?

Цитата:

попутно создав "вычислительную сеть" или банальный ботнет?
Уже бегу, ога.

slesh 26.07.2009 15:29

>>> А если предположить что пароль только англ символы 24 варианта и длинна 8 символов то это займет 212 суток. <<<
ну соберешь ты от силы компов 30 с топовыми видюхами и то они будут неделю беспрерывно брутить

RedAlert 26.07.2009 15:55

Чуть подправлю расчёты слеша .
Берём таблицу аски , смотрим печатных символов там 94 (с учётом знаков припинания и спец символов) + 33 русских буквы = получаем 127 символов

Количество возможных комбинаций расчитывается по формуле A^X , где A - мощьность алфовита (кол-во всех символов) , а X длинна пароля в символах . Даже если пароль 10 символов получаем 127^10 вариантов , что при скоросте в 10к в секунду даёт всего
127^10/10^4 = 109153385307339354 секунды = 30320384807594 часа = 3461231142 лет . А надеятся на удачу глупо , ты же не будешь ломать архивы каких нить ламеров? (да тут можно надеятся на удачу , но у ламеров то ничего интересного то и нету , так что понту ломать их архивы?) А нормальные люди ставят пароль в >10 символов со спец символами, да и кстати Rijndael который используется в винраре устойчив к бруту . Если тебе повезёт твои правнуки сломают архив :)

PS: SmanxX1 помоему умничаешь ты , какие нафиг вычислительные сети , какие ботнеты , ты даже простейшую нейро сеть наверное не в состоянии написать ...

SmanxX1 26.07.2009 16:26

slesh
Цитата:

ну соберешь ты от силы компов 30 с топовыми видюхами и то они будут неделю беспрерывно брутить
Дык кто спорит? Я тебя просто подправил, что в настоящее время есть возможность перебирать более чем 200 паролей в секунду. ;)

RedAlert
Цитата:

да и кстати AES который используется в винраре устойчив к бруту
Ты прям открыватель америк.

Цитата:

ты даже простейшую нейро сеть наверное не в состоянии написать ...
Откуда же ты знаешь уровень моих знаний и что ты вообще знаешь про нейросети? Давай поговорим на эту тему, захлебнешься в математике. И объясни мне, пожалуйста, что такое "простейшие нейросети"?


П.С. Дабы пост не считался оффтопом.
Ссылки по теме(компоненты для делфи, которые ТС мог бы и сам найти):
http://www.rarlab.com/rar/TDFUnRar.zip
http://www.rarlab.com/rar/RARComponent_12.zip


Время: 00:18